The Course

The TCS New York City Marathon is the biggest marathons in the world with over 55,000 finishers in 2024, so don’t miss out! The atmosphere alone will get you through those 42.2 kilometres.

Run alongside amateurs, professional competitors and world record holders as you weave your way through the 5 boroughs of Staten Island, Brooklyn, Queens, the Bronx, and Manhattan, over 5 bridges and finish in the world renowned Central Park. The course is broken down as follows (description from Runners World):

Staten Island (Miles 1-2)
Not much time is spent in Staten Island: only two miles. When the race starts, runners cross the Verrazano Narrows Bridge, which offers sweeping views of the New York Harbor and skyline, including the Statue of Liberty. The first mile is an uphill climb up the bridge, while the second mile is downhill, heading off the bridge to Brooklyn.

Brooklyn (Miles 3-12)
These next 11 miles is run in the relatively flat streets of Brooklyn. Runners are able to enjoy the colourful quirks of each neighbourhood in the borough, from the trendy restaurants in Park Slope to the charming tree-lined streets on Lafayette Avenue to the lively crowds in Williamsburg.

Queens (Miles 13-15)
Near the midpoint of the race, comes the Queensboro Bridge at mile 14. While the vantage point offers beautiful views, the climb up the bridge is tough, and the absence of spectators on this stretch can be mentally challenging. This section is quiet compared to the rest of the race.

Manhattan Part 1 (Miles 16-18)
After descending the Queensboro Bridge onto Manhattan’s First Avenue, runners are swallowed by a swell of spectators. This is a flat, three-mile stretch.

The Bronx (Miles 19-20)
Whilst crossing into The Bronx, the crowds have thinned from First Avenue. There are bands and dancers at the Entertainment Zone at 139th and Morris Avenue.

Manhattan Part 2 (Miles 21-26.2)
The final 10K of the marathon is long and possibly painful but with the roaring crowds in the heart of the Big Apple, plus the final miles through iconic Central Park, the last push is worth it. From here it is a quick spin through Harlem and a run up Fifth Avenue, reaching the northern edge of Central Park around mile 23. The next mile is fairly flat along Fifth. Once inside Central Park around mile 24, there are a couple rolling hills. At mile 25 you’ll be surrounded by deafening crowds near Columbus Circle. Then it’s just two quick turns before the finish.

Start Time

The first wave starts at 9.10am and last Wave (5) starts at 11:30am.

Cut-Off Times

Sweep buses will follow the marathon route at a roughly 16 minutes per mile pace after the final wave start. These buses will transport any entrant who wishes to drop out to the post-finish area. After the sweep buses pass, the city streets will reopen to traffic. Cross-street protection, medical assistance, aid stations, and other services will no longer be available. Runners on the course should move onto the sidewalks.

The official end time of the race is 10:00pm.

Race Timing

The ChronoTrack timing system is used at the TCS New York City Marathon to record the time of every runner.

Mile markers are posted at every mile, and kilometre signs are posted every 5 kilometres.

Timing mats are located at the start, every 5K, halfway (13.1 miles), mile 20, and the finish.

Race Packets

Registration is at the Jacob K. Javits Convention Center

Note that all runners are required to attend in person to collect their registration.

Pace Setters

There are pace setters in the TCS New York City Marathon.

The pacers will be in or near their corrals roughly 15 to 20 minutes before the start of the race. This will give you a chance to talk to them, learn more about the race plan, and ask questions. They’ll be wearing blue-and-white striped singlets, and will be carrying signs that show the pace and finish time that their group plans to run. 

Aid Stations

Purified water will be available at official fluid stations every mile from mile 3 to mile 25 except at miles 5, 7, and 9.

Gatorade® Endurance Formula™ Lemon-Lime Flavor will be available at official fluid stations every mile from mile 3 to mile 25, except at miles 5, 7, and 9.

Fluids will be dispensed in compostable cups. There will be tables on both sides of the course. To avoid the bottleneck at the first table, get a cup from a later table. Please keep moving after you pick up your cup.

Personal Refreshments and Clothing

No personal refreshments are able to be left out on the course and all discarded clothing will be collected for charity.

Finishes T-Shirts, Medals and Certificates

All runners will receive a sports top in their race packs (provided by the TCS New York City Marathon).

Only runners who complete the TCS New York City Marathon will receive a medal once they have crossed the finish line.

Your finisher certificate will be mailed to you after the event.

Weather Conditions

The average temperature range for New York in November is 7 to 15 degrees Celsius (45 to 62 degrees Fahrenheit).
